Manny Pacquiao Says Billionaire Friends Ready To Invest If Elected

 Sen. Manny Pacquiao said he has at least 10 international billionaire friends on stand by to invest in the country if elected, with condition, to eradicate corruption.





"May mga kaibigan ako na mga malalaking negosyante at mga mayayaman sa ibang bansa na naka-ready na tumulong sa Pilipinas. Ayaw lang talaga nila itong napakatinding korapsyon sa ating gobyerno," said Pacquiao.





He also said that it's really hard to invite investors to come to the country if the neighboring countries are imposing lower corporate tax at 20% only. But for Pacquiao he wants "flat 15%", revealing Singapore is at 17% only. 



"Kailangan nating pababain ang ating corporate tax at palakasin ang ating nontax revenues," he added.

If elected, he also promised to stop red tape by strengthening the implementation of the Republic Act 11032 or the "Ease of Doing Business Act" to ensure all related business permits and documents are processed in not more than three days.
